Troy University to offer "Instant Piano" course in Dothan

DOTHAN—Troy University’s Continuing Education Center will offer another session of the popular “Instant Piano” course for novice musicians on Monday, Feb. 25.

 

The one-night class will be held from 6 p.m. to 9:30 p.m. at the Dothan Campus, inside Adams Hall.

 

Perfect for anyone who has always wanted to play the piano but felt they did not have the time to learn, "Instant Piano for Hopelessly Busy People" will introduce participants to the basic techniques needed to make piano playing a part of their lives. Instructor David Haynes focuses on chord techniques, and will teach participants the skills needed to play any song in any style or key.

 

Registration is $50 plus a $25 materials fee that covers a book and practice CD.

 

Space is limited and preregistration is required. For more information, or to register, call (334) 983-0005.
